首页主机资讯Java编译时出现乱码怎么解决

Java编译时出现乱码怎么解决

时间2025-12-11 18:28:03发布访客分类主机资讯浏览508
导读:在Java编译过程中,如果遇到乱码问题,通常是由于编码设置不一致导致的。以下是一些建议来解决这个问题: 确保源代码文件的编码与编译器使用的编码一致。例如,如果你的源代码文件是以UTF-8编码保存的,那么在编译时也需要指定UTF-8编码。可...

在Java编译过程中,如果遇到乱码问题,通常是由于编码设置不一致导致的。以下是一些建议来解决这个问题:

  1. 确保源代码文件的编码与编译器使用的编码一致。例如,如果你的源代码文件是以UTF-8编码保存的,那么在编译时也需要指定UTF-8编码。可以使用以下命令来编译:
javac -encoding UTF-8 YourJavaFile.java
  1. 如果你使用的是集成开发环境(IDE),请检查IDE的编码设置。确保IDE使用的编码与源代码文件的编码一致。例如,在Eclipse中,你可以在"Window" > “Preferences” > “General” > "Workspace"中设置编码。

  2. 如果问题仍然存在,可以尝试将源代码文件的编码转换为编译器使用的编码。可以使用一些文本编辑器(如Notepad++、Sublime Text等)来实现编码转换。

  3. 如果你在运行Java程序时遇到乱码问题,可以尝试在运行命令中指定编码。例如,如果你的程序输出到控制台,可以使用以下命令:

java -Dfile.encoding=UTF-8 YourMainClass

希望这些建议能帮助你解决Java编译时的乱码问题。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: Java编译时出现乱码怎么解决
本文地址: https://pptw.com/jishu/769625.html
Debian系统中fetchdebian的默认设置是什么 如何用ifconfig设置Ubuntu的网络MTU值

游客 回复需填写必要信息